Key Steps in a Smooth Real Estate Purchase
Property purchase is a significant financial decision that involves acquiring property for private use, investment, or development. It’s a complex process that will require consideration of various factors to make sure a successful transaction. One of many key aspects of property purchase is thorough research and due diligence. Prospective buyers need to research industry, evaluate property values, and gauge the possibility of appreciation or rental income. Additionally, understanding local zoning laws, building codes, and regulations is vital to prevent any legal complications.
Another essential part of real estate purchase is securing financing. Most buyers count on mortgage loans to finance their property acquisitions. It’s essential to search around to discover the best mortgage rates and terms and to have pre-approved for a loan prior to starting the house-hunting process. Pre-approval demonstrates to sellers that the client is serious and financially capable of completing the purchase.
Once financing is secured, the next phase in real-estate purchase is finding the right property. Buyers must look into their needs, preferences, and budget when looking for homes or investment properties. Working together with a qualified real estate agent can streamline the method by giving usage of listing databases, scheduling property viewings, and negotiating offers with respect to the buyer.
After identifying an appropriate property, buyers must conduct thorough inspections to assess its condition and identify any potential issues. Hiring qualified inspectors to examine the property’s structure, systems, and components can uncover hidden defects which could affect its value or require costly repairs. On the basis of the inspection findings, buyers can renegotiate the cost or request repairs or credits from the seller Skup Nieruchomości .
Once inspections are complete and all contingencies are satisfied, the last step in property purchase is closing the deal. This implies signing the necessary legal documents, transferring ownership of the property, and disbursing funds to the seller. Closing typically takes place at a concept company or attorney’s office and may involve various parties, including real-estate agents, attorneys, lenders, and escrow officers.
